End-ischemic dual hypothermic oxygenated machine perfusion (DHOPE) of human donor livers mitigates ischemia-reperfusion injury, resulting in a reduction of post-reperfusion syndrome, early allograft dysfunction and biliary complications, when compared with static cold storage. End-ischemic DHOPE can be used to prolong donor liver preservation time for up to 24 hours. According to IDEAL-D (Idea, Development, Exploration, Assessment, Long term study-Framework for Devices), scientific evidence for prolonged DHOPE has currently reached stage 3. Assessment of long-term outcomes after prolonged DHOPE preservation based on real-world data (i.e., IDEAL-D stage 4) is currently still lacking.

The aim of this study is to assess long-term outcomes after transplantation of donor livers preserved by prolonged hypothermic oxygenated machine perfusion (DHOPE-PRO).
